Abstract

L'invention concerne une solution pour sélectionner un procédé de contention dans un réseau sans fil. Selon un aspect, un procédé consiste à : établir, par un appareil, une association avec un nœud d'accès d'un réseau sans fil; recevoir, par l'appareil pendant l'association, une première trame comprenant une première valeur d'un paramètre de sélection pour une sélection entre un premier procédé de contention et un second procédé de contention dans le réseau sans fil et sélectionner l'un parmi le premier procédé de contention et le second procédé de contention sur la base de la première valeur; et recevoir, par l'appareil pendant l'association, une seconde trame comprenant une seconde valeur, différente de la première valeur, du paramètre de sélection pour une sélection entre le premier procédé de contention et le second procédé de contention et sélectionner l'un parmi le premier procédé de contention et le second procédé de contention sur la base de la seconde valeur.
